As of the end of 2024, there have been 25 NRL Premierships and 116 overall, including the competition's predecessors (NSWRL, ARL and *Super League). This is a list of all the grand finals that were played to decide those premierships. The premierships not decided by a grand final were determined by league ladder position. The 1982 NSWRFL season was the 75th season of professional rugby league football in Australia and saw the New South Wales Rugby Football League’s first expansion since 1967 with the introduction of the first two clubs from outside the Sydney area in over half a century: the Canberra Raiders and the Illawarra … Meer weergeven The first Charity Shield match was played before the 1982 season between St. George and South Sydney.
